Invisible Stains

Fabric Care Tips

April 03, 2023

Often stains that are caused by food, oily type substances or beverages may become invisible when they dry. Later on, with time and or exposure to heat, a yellow or brownish stain will appear. This is caused by the oxidation or caramelization of the sugar in the staining substance. Once the stains become yellow or brown they become more difficult to remove.


Bring your stained garment to your local Martinizing Cleaners as soon as possible after wearing to prevent the stain from setting. Remember to point out any stains or areas where spills may have occurred and dried invisible to your Dry Cleaner when dropping off your items for cleaning. If you are aware of what spilled on the garment please share that information also, as it will aid in the proper treatment and removal of the stain.
